Keanu Reeves Reportedly In Talks To Join Angelina Jolie In MCU's The Eternals


It looks like Marvel Studios has huge plans for its upcoming film The Eternals. The highly anticipated Marvel Cinematic Universe flick already has big names like Angelina Jolie, Richard Madden, and Kumail Nanjiani attached. Now the next A-lister that could join the high-profile project might be Keanu Reeves.

A new report from MCU Cosmic states that Reeves is currently in negotiations to take on a lead role in The Eternals. However, the report did not reveal which role the John Wick: Chapter 3 - Parabellum actor is being considered for. If Reeves and Marvel Studios makes a deal, the Toy Story 4 star is expected to take on a major part in the Chloe Zhao movie.

Interestingly, this isn't the first time that Reeves has been rumored to be joining The Eternals. It was previously reported that the Always Be My Maybe actor is in talks to play the main villain in the MCU movie. Reeves is said to be the only actor being considered for the role of Druig, an Eternal who seeks power and is a talented warrior. It certainly sounds like a great role for the Matrix star.

The idea of Reeves playing a Marvel villain isn't actually a new one. After all, the Bill and Ted actor was the original choice to portray Yon-Rogg in Captain Marvel but Reeves had to bow out due to scheduling conflicts with John Wick 3. The role eventually went to Jude Law but Reeves reportedly wanted to get a Marvel role when his schedule allows it. Hopefully, this time he could finally join the MCU.
